Major global companies in the Smart Low Side Switch market include Infineon Technologies, ROHM Semiconductor, STMicroelectronics, Texas Instruments, Analog Devices (Maxim Integrated), Toshiba, TOREX SEMICONDUCTOR LTD. and Suzhou Novosense Microelectronics, among others.
